body    {
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 14px }
p  { margin-top: 0 }
#quicklinks   {
	color: black;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	margin: 8px 0;
	border: solid 1px #609 }
.announcement    {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 14px;
	padding-top: 15px;
	padding-bottom: 8px }
.announcement a {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 14px;
	padding-top: 15px;
	padding-bottom: 8px }
.announcement a:hover {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 14px;
	padding-top: 15px;
	padding-bottom: 8px }
.slogan  {
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 14px;
	background-color: #ffc;
	padding-top: 15px;
	padding-bottom: 8px }
.slogan h2 {
	color: #609;
	font-size: 14px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-weight: normal;
	background-color: #ffc;
	margin-top: 0 }
#quicklinks td  {
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	background-color: white }
#quicklinks a  {
	color: black;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	text-decoration: none }
#quicklinks a:hover   {
	color: #609;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	text-decoration: underline }
a   {
	color: #399;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line }
a:hover    {
	color: #609;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line }
h1   {
	color: #609;
	font-size: 18px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-weight: normal;
	background: url("../images/orange_underline.gif") repeat-x 50% bottom;
	margin-bottom: 10px;
	padding-bottom: 5px }
h1 sup   {
	font-size: 0.5em;
	padding-left: 1px;
	vertical-align: text-top; }
h1.home   {
	color: #609;
	font-size: 16px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-weight: normal;
	background: url("../images/orange_underline.gif") repeat-x 50% bottom;
	margin-bottom: 10px;
	padding-bottom: 5px }
h2     {
	color: #609;
	font-size: 14px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-weight: normal;
	margin: 15px 0 10px }
h3    {
	color: #609;
	font-size: 12px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-weight: normal;
	background-color: transparent;
	margin: 15px 0 3px;
	padding-bottom: 2px }
h4   {
	color: #399;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	margin: 15px 0 0 }

sup   {
	font-size: 0.7em;
	padding-left: 1px;
	vertical-align: text-top; }
td     {
	color: #333;
	font-size: 12px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 15px }
.barleft { border-left: 1px dotted #609 }
#bull_list   { font-family: Arial, Helvetica, SunSans-Regular, sans-serif; list-style: none; margin-top: 5px; margin-left: 0; padding-left: 0 }
#bull_list li    { background-image: url("../images/bullet.gif"); background-repeat: no-repeat; background-position: 0 0.2em; padding-bottom: 4px; padding-left: 15px }
.footer   { color: #609; font-size: 9px; margin-top: 10px }
.footer a  {
	color: #609;
	font-size: 9px;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line }
.footer a:hover  {
	color: #399;
	font-size: 9px;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line }
.nav_util  {
	color: white;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	margin-top: 1px;
	margin-bottom: 0 }
.nav_util a {
	color: white;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	text-decoration: none }
.nav_util a:hover {
	color: #fc3;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	text-decoration: underline }
.nav3  {
	color: #999;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	margin-top: 1px;
	margin-bottom: 0 }
.nav3 a  {
	color: #399;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	text-decoration: underline }
.nav3 a:hover  {
	color: #609;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	text-decoration: underline }
.data_table { border: solid 1px #609 }
.data_table td { color: #333; font-size: 11px; font-family: Arial, Helvetica, sans-serif }
.data_table a {
	color: #399;
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if }
.data_table a:hover {
	color: #609;
	font-size: 11px;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line }
.data_table h1  {
	color: #fff;
	font-size: 12px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-stretch: normal;
	background-image: none;
	text-transform: uppercase;
	letter-spacing: 2px;
	margin: 0;
	padding: 0 }
.light    {
	background-color: #f5f5f5;
	border-right: 1px dotted #999;
	border-left: none }
.dark  {
	background-color: #ebebeb;
	border-right: 1px dotted #999 }
.content    {
	padding: 20px }
.right_col { padding-top: 25px }

 #navcontainer
   {
	color: #333;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	background-color: #90c;
	padding: 0;
	width: 200px }
#navcontainer ul
{
list-style: none;
margin: 0;
padding: 0;
border: none;
}

#navcontainer li
   {
	margin: 0;
	border-bottom: 1px dotted #fc6 }

#navcontainer li a
   {
	color: #fff;
	font-size: 13px;
	text-decoration: none;
	background-color: #90c;
	display: block;
	padding: 5px 5px 5px 16px;
	width: 100%;
	border-right: 10px solid #c6f;
	border-left: 10px solid #609 }
	
html>body #navcontainer li a {
	width: auto; }

#navcontainer li a:hover
  {
	color: #fff;
	background-color: #93f;
	border-right: 10px solid #c6f;
	border-left: 10px solid #609 }
.rightnav  {
	color: #666;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-weight: bold;
	padding: 67px 10px 10px }
.rightnav a {
	color: #666;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-weight: bold;
	text-decoration: none;
	padding: 0 }
.rightnav a:hover {
	color: #609;
	font-size: 11px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-weight: bold;
	text-decoration: underline }
.rightnav h4  {
	color: #666;
	font-size: 12px;
	font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if;
	font-weight: bold;
	text-transform: uppercase;
	letter-spacing: 2px;
	padding: 5px 0 12px;
	border-top: 1px dotted #666 }

